Mailchimp: A Popular Choice for Beginners
Mailchimp is known for its user-friendly interface. It’s ideal for beginners. The platform offers a free plan. This is great for small businesses starting out. Paid plans unlock more features. Automation and segmentation capabilities are quite strong. Mailchimp integrates well with many other platforms. Their extensive help documentation is incredibly useful.
Mailchimp’s Strengths and Weaknesses
Mailchimp’s ease of use is a significant advantage. Its free plan is a great starting point. However, its pricing can increase rapidly. More advanced features cost extra. For large lists, other providers might offer better value.
Constant Contact: Reliable and Feature-Rich
Constant Contact is a reliable and established provider. It offers a wide range of features. The platform focuses on ease of use and deliverability. Their customer support is highly rated. They provide excellent resources and tutorials. They offer a variety of email templates.
Constant Contact’s Pricing and Integrations
Constant Contact’s pricing is competitive. It offers a range of plans to accommodate different needs. Their integrations cover various popular platforms. This ensures a smooth workflow. Consider their features when comparing options.
ConvertKit: Ideal for Creators and Influencers
ConvertKit is popular among bloggers and creators. It excels at email automation. This makes it ideal for nurturing leads and building relationships. Its landing page builder is a valuable asset. This helps to grow your email list efficiently.
ConvertKit’s Unique Features
ConvertKit’s focus on creator needs sets it apart. Its robust automation tools are powerful. Its user-friendly interface is intuitive. However, it may lack some features found in other platforms. Consider your specific requirements before committing.

ActiveCampaign: Powerful Automation and CRM Features
ActiveCampaign is a robust platform. It offers powerful automation and CRM features. This makes it a good choice for businesses that need advanced functionalities. It’s more complex than Mailchimp, requiring more time to master.
GetResponse: All-in-One Marketing Platform
GetResponse offers a comprehensive suite of marketing tools. This includes email marketing, landing pages, and webinars. It’s a great option if you need an all-in-one solution. Its pricing is competitive, but it’s important to evaluate your needs before choosing.
